Early Life and Education

Born on January 1, 1997, in Lahore, Pakistan, Nimra grew up in Karachi in a supportive family. Her father, Dr. Muhammad Shabbir, has been her biggest cheerleader, while her brother Xahid prefers staying away from the spotlight. Coming from an Arain family, Nimra originally carried the surname “Mehar,” but she cleverly modified it to “Mehra” to stand out on social media — a name that soon became her iconic stage identity.

She completed her early schooling in Karachi and later earned a diploma from the prestigious Indus Valley School of Art and Architecture. Even as a young student, music was her true calling. She auditioned for Pakistan Idol in 2013 but faced rejection — a moment that could have ended her dreams. Instead, it fueled her determination to prove herself through hard work.

Career Beginnings and Rise to Fame

Nimra started her professional journey around 2014, slowly building a name in the Punjabi music scene. Her breakthrough came with emotionally charged tracks that resonated deeply with listeners. Songs like “Tu Subha Di Pak Hawa Warga” exploded on YouTube in 2023, racking up millions of views and turning her into a household name.

She has performed on major platforms, including Coke Studio Season 8, and has toured internationally, with her 2024 UK tour being a massive success. Today, she boasts over 1 million followers on Instagram (@nimramehraofficial) and 226,000+ monthly listeners on Spotify.

Here are some of her most popular songs:

  • Je Pata Hunda
  • Tu Subha Di Pak Hawa Warga
  • Zehar
  • Yaar Mod Dey
  • Goli Maar Di
  • Wareya (2025 release)

Her music often mixes heartbreak, love, and empowerment, making her a favorite among young audiences.

Personal Life and Achievements

Nimra keeps her personal life relatively private. She is unmarried (as of early 2026), and rumors about her wedding or relationships remain just speculation. Her family remains her anchor, and she often credits her father for encouraging her musical dreams.

Beyond singing, Nimra is a Goodwill Ambassador for Women’s Empowerment with the International Human Rights Commission — a role that reflects her commitment to inspiring women. She is also active on social media, sharing glimpses of her life, shoots, and behind-the-scenes moments.

Challenges and Recent Updates

Like many artists, Nimra has faced ups and downs. In 2025–2026, she publicly spoke about a dispute with her former label, Beyond Records, regarding song rights — a situation that highlighted the importance of artist protection in the industry. Despite the controversy, she continues to release new music and perform, proving her resilience.

Her latest track “Wareya” (2025) has been praised as a heartfelt anthem, showing she’s still evolving as an artist.
